Web11 de set. de 2024 · The Benefits of Magnesium Citrate Supplements. Magnesium citrate can be helpful to alleviate constipation. If you find yourself backed up and experiencing the symptoms of constipation, magnesium citrate pills may help relieve your discomfort. Magnesium citrate has other benefits beyond its laxative effect, so knowing … WebMagnesium citrate is a saline laxative that is thought to work by increasing fluid in the small intestine. It usually results in a bowel movement within 30 minutes to 3 hours. How to use...
